Abstract

Prostate‐specific membrane antigen (PSMA) is known to be overexpressed in prostate cancer (PCa). The development of precise and rapid imaging technologies to monitor PSMA is crucial for early diagnosis and therapy. Fluorescence imaging in the second near‐infrared window (NIR‐II) has emerged as a powerful tool for real‐time tracking and in vivo visualization, offering high sensitivity and resolution. However, there is a lack of stable, bright and easy‐to‐implement NIR‐II fluorescent probes for PSMA targeting. Herein, we presented a PSMA‐targeting NIR‐II fluorescent probe FC‐PSMA based on π‐conjugated crossbreeding dyed strategy that affords high stability, large extinction coefficient, and good brightness. As demonstrated, FC‐PSMA displayed a high fluorescence quantum yield in fetal bovine serum (FBS). Following intravenous injection of FC‐PSMA, the tumor‐to‐normal ratio of fluorescence intensity steadily increased over time, reaching a peak at 48 h (tumor‐to‐leg ratio = 12.16 ± 0.90). This advancement enables precise identification of PC through NIR‐II fluorescence imaging, facilitating high‐performance guidance for prostate cancer resection surgery.
